Lightbulb BMW presenting 3 interior design concepts at DESIGNMAI 2007

At DESIGNMAI 2007 in Berlin BMW Group exhibit 3 very interesting design interior design concepts - showing how creativity of designers and analytic skills of scientists can lead to interesting new theories & phenomenas. The exhibited items show how specific forms and structures affect people's perception. BMW Group will use these scientific findings & design realizations for interior design guidance when designing new vehicles.


Concept #1: "Concentration"




This object shows how human eye can be forced to focus. Concept #1 is a funnel-shaped object with a heterogeneous surface made of numerous different tiles. With increasing distance from viewer the tiles' size decreases - forcing human eyes & brain to be more focused.



Concept #2: "Relatedness"



Concept #2 shows the arrangement of two seats in opposite line of sight, producing a particularly high relatedness - especially since optical and haptic contact does not exist, yet the both seats are a part of single curved structure.


Concept #3: "Concinnity"



Model number three symbolizes balance by the integration of seat and armrests into a structure consisting of several layers. The layered structure with free spaces between the levels leads to a balance between fullness and emptiness.

Yep, "layering" and softer, more organic shapes will be featured in future BMW interiors.

According to the above posted concepts we will also see some layering (to stress sporty luxury), "metal origami" in some models (Z-series?), and continued & related shapes and lines (when several elements are a part of "one" piece / structure).

I'm thrilled to see interiors of upcoming F01 7er, F5 LSC, E89 Z4, Z8 & new 8er.

I'm happy to see BMW finally heading towards paying more attention to details - when it comes to interiors. Current interiors are fresh, modern, avant-garde, interesting - yet they lack some refinement & sophistication. New interiors will feature a great amount nicely designed details (levers, knobs, buttons, shafts, surfaces, steering wheel, seats etc) ... It's about time ... Eg. new Renault Laguna (Passat rival) is coming with very sophisticated interior with many nicely designed details ... And BMW as a premium brand should do it even more so.
